Travelling to Ruskin Lodge is a pleasure in itself and whether you are coming by ferry, car, boat or train the journey will take you through some glorious countryside.

Directions from Glasgow (via ferry):

Follow the M8 to Gourock then follow signs for the Hunter’s Quay ferry. After the 20 minute ferry journey, turn right and follow signs for the A815 to Strachur. Once you are on the A815 you will see a Forestry Commission sign for Pucks Glen and the Lodges are next track on your right. Look for the number 6 by the door to the lodge.

Direction from Glasgow (by road only):

Follow the A82 up Loch Lomond to Tarbat, then take the A83 until you see signs for the A815 just before Cairndow. Follow the A815 through Strachur and inland past Loch Eck

A car is recommended but there are public transport options too. There are local bus stops at Benmore Botanical Gardens, Uig and Cot House and bus routes link the area to Dunoon, west to Portavadie, south to Ardentinny and north to Strachur, Loch Fyne and Inveraray. There is a car ferry route from Hunters Quay to McInroy's Point and a passenger ferry from Dunoon to Gourock.
